1. 首页
  2. 课程学习
  3. Java
  4. 深入解析Java注解的内涵(探讨注解概念、本质与应用)

深入解析Java注解的内涵(探讨注解概念、本质与应用)

上传者: 2023-11-24 07:42:05上传 DOCX文件 18.13KB 热度 53次

Java注解是一种元数据,它为程序中的类、方法、变量等元素添加了额外的信息。通过注解,开发者可以在代码中添加元数据信息,这些信息可以被编译器、工具或者运行时通过反射机制获取和利用。注解的本质在于它们并非直接影响代码的运行,而是为代码提供了更多的辅助信息。使用反射机制可以获取注解的信息,比如类的结构、方法的信息等。元注解是用于修饰其他注解的注解,它可以给注解赋予更多的属性或者限制注解的使用方式。注解的属性可以有不同的数据类型,其中,value是一个特别的属性,它可以用于简化注解的使用方式。另外,注解的属性还可以是数组类型,这为开发者提供了更多的灵活性和多样性。

用户评论